Understanding Forex Robots


A forex robot is an algorithmic tool analyzing currency data and generates alerts for trading for forex pairs based on set methodologies.

It autonomously examines price trajectories, technical indicators, or analytical frameworks to determine entry points, position sizes, and exits. By eliminating emotional influences, it targets trade execution with impartiality and regularity.

These robots seamlessly connect with brokers’ platforms to send commands sans manual intervention. Also known as trading bots or expert advisors, they operate via instructions derived from analytical criteria, news feeds, or microstructural insights when suitably programmed.

While they operate around the clock in various regions, observation remains important since unforeseen developments might affect market conditions beyond coded assumptions.

Functionality of Forex Robots Explored


Forex robots perform their functions by consistently scanning real-time market data and applying predefined trading strategies to determine potential trade openings. They utilize technical analysis, including moving averages and relative strength index, to evaluate trends and patterns.

You can set up these robots to engage in automatic trading or merely generate signals for your action. They are commonly used with MetaTrader platforms (MT4 and MT5) and capable of processing various conditions like entry conditions and stop-loss orders simultaneously.

For example, a robot can autonomously place buy or sell requests based on specific price formations if certain conditions are satisfied.

Workflow of Automated Trading


In designing an automated trading process, develop a precise strategy that defines when and how trades should be executed. This entails setting guidelines based on technical indicators like moving averages and RSI, as well as risk management measures such as position sizing and evaluative metrics.

As you initiate, encode it into a platform like MetaTrader using MQL5. The system persistently watches the market for opportunities based on your stipulated rules, managing trades without intervention.

This process permits efficient trading devoid of emotional bias, operating unceasingly even when you're not present.

Integration With Trading Platforms


Integration with broker systems affects how effectively your forex robot can perform automated trades and correspond to market data.

Popular suites like MetaTrader 4 (MT4) and MetaTrader 5 (MT5) support Forex robots by providing IDE components (IDEs) such as MQL4 and MQL5 for program development, verification, and deployment of Expert Advisors (EAs) or bots.

These ecosystems facilitate for your robot to handle real-time data, automatic order fulfillment, and oversee risk parameters according to precodified logic.

Achievement of compatibility with the trading platform guarantees seamless interaction for order execution, analytical processes, and strategic refines.

Configuring and Personalizing Trading Bots


Configuring and customizing a forex mechanism involves a sequence of steps to verify efficient operation.

You need to define your trading strategy, detailing entry-exit markers, risk parameters, and trading frequency.

Platforms like MetaTrader, EA Studio, or Capitalise.ai facilitate automation design using coding languages like MQL4 or MQL5, or employing visual setups for code-free options.

Backtesting with past data is critical for proving effectiveness.

Define loss containment and profit-taking parameters, illustratively between 10 and 100 pips, and enforce criteria like a minimum trade count for robust checks.

If applying platforms like MT5, ensure your EA suits coupling with MQL5.

Benefits and Limitations of Using Forex Robots


Forex robots enable continuous monitoring, and conduct transactions without human emotion, enabling capture of opportunities round-the-clock, five days a week.

They offer several advantages, such as enhanced trading efficiency, accelerated decision-making, and autonomous operation, offering peace of mind.

Conversely, forex robots pose challenges. They demand accurate configuration which may overwhelm inexperienced traders.

Furthermore, robots may encounter difficulties with volatile markets and rely on static guidelines, potentially resulting in missed opportunities or losses if incorrectly managed.
